Amazon Flipkart Snapdeal Tata CLiQ Reliance Digital ShopClues Paytm Mall JioMart Meesho Indiamart Myntra AJIO Nykaa Nykaa Fashion Koovs Bewakoof...
Generated Prompt
## APPLICATION OVERVIEW FABZ is a web application designed to serve as a centralized e-commerce platform that aggregates items from popular online retailers like Flipkart, Amazon, Blinkit, and Zepto. Users can select products from different e-commerce sites and have them delivered to their chosen location through FABZ’s local stations, ensuring instant delivery and a seamless shopping experience. ## CORE FEATURES 1. **Product Aggregation**: Users can browse and search for items from multiple e-commerce platforms in one place, making it easy to compare prices and products. 2. **Local Stations**: Users can select from various FABZ stations for quick pick-up or delivery, enhancing convenience and reducing delivery times. 3. **Instant Delivery**: Partnering with local delivery services, FABZ offers instant delivery options for selected products, ensuring freshness and timeliness. 4. **User Accounts**: Customers can create and manage accounts to track orders, save favorite items, and receive personalized recommendations. 5. **Secure Payment Options**: The app supports various payment methods, including credit/debit cards, net banking, and wallets, ensuring a secure checkout process. 6. **Promotions & Discounts**: Users can view current promotions and discounts available across different retailers, allowing them to save while shopping. ## DESIGN SPECIFICATIONS - **Visual Style**: Minimalist design emphasizing clean lines, ample white space, and a straightforward user interface that prioritizes usability. - **Color Mode**: Light theme featuring a minimal color palette, primarily using soft whites and light grays for backgrounds, with dark text for easy readability. - **Layout**: A grid layout for product displays, with a top navigation bar for easy access to different sections, a prominent search bar, and clear categorization of products. - **Typography**: Use of sans-serif fonts like 'Roboto' for body text and a slightly bolder font for headings to create a clear typographic hierarchy. Ensure sufficient font size for readability. ## TECHNICAL REQUIREMENTS - **Framework**: React with TypeScript for a robust and type-safe development experience. - **Styling**: Tailwind CSS for efficient and responsive styling, allowing for quick adjustments and consistent design. - **UI Components**: Utilize shadcn/ui for a collection of pre-designed components that align with the minimalist aesthetic. - **State Management**: Consider using React Context API or Zustand for state management to handle user sessions and product selections. ## IMPLEMENTATION STEPS 1. **Set Up the Development Environment**: Initialize a new React project with TypeScript and install Tailwind CSS and shadcn/ui. 2. **Design the Layout**: Create the main layout structure with a header, footer, and main content area utilizing Tailwind CSS for responsive design. 3. **Implement Navigation**: Build a navigation bar that includes links to different product categories and a search functionality. 4. **Create Product Components**: Develop reusable components for displaying products, including features for adding items to the cart and viewing product details. 5. **Integrate Local Station Selection**: Add functionality for users to choose their preferred FABZ station for delivery or pick-up. 6. **Set Up User Authentication**: Implement user account management features, including sign-up, login, and profile management. 7. **Implement Payment Gateway**: Integrate a secure payment processing solution to handle transactions efficiently. 8. **Test the Application**: Conduct thorough testing for functionality, usability, and responsiveness across different devices. ## USER EXPERIENCE Users will experience a streamlined shopping journey that begins with an easy-to-navigate landing page featuring a search bar and highlighted promotions. They can effortlessly browse products, filter by categories, and view detailed product descriptions. The checkout experience is simple, allowing for quick payment and selection of delivery methods. After placing an order, users receive real-time updates on their delivery status, ensuring they remain informed throughout the process.
Loved by thousands of makers from
From early prototypes to real products, they started here.







































Generate optimized prompts for your vibe coding projects
Generate prompt
Enter a brief description of the app you want to build and get an optimized prompt
Review and use your prompt
Review (and edit if necessary) the generated prompt, then copy it or open it directly in your chosen platform
Get inspired with new ideas
Get AI-generated suggestions to expand your product with features that will surprise your users
Frequently Asked Questions
Everything you need to know about creating better prompts for your Lovable projects
Still have questions?
Can't find what you're looking for? We're here to help!
